Our rolled labels and stickers are in a gloss finish as standard. Gloss is much more suited to our professional grade printer and allows the colours to pop.

Our sticker sheets are available in Matt as standard but can be sourced in Gloss, we just don’t hold gloss stock.

Being kind to the environment is something we strive to achieve. As we send stickers, we do have to ensure they withhold the wet and windy postal system but as we grow and develop, we will invest in more environmentally positive practices. All our stickers are FSC certified.

We have reduced the use of cellophane wraps on sticker rolls in favour of a paper band and ditched our plastic tape.

We do still use some non-eco items but we are trying to replace them when they run out.
